Data Engineer

Softblues Top Employer

Our client is seeking a motivated and skilled Data Engineer to join their core Data Engineering team. This is a hands-on role designed for a technical expert who enjoys building robust data architectures and working directly with the Modern Data Stack

As a Data Engineer, you will be responsible for designing, developing, and optimizing data transformation pipelines. You will play a crucial role in turning raw data into actionable insights by leveraging Snowflake and dbt to ensure high-quality, scalable data delivery.
 

Key Responsibilities:

  • Design and build sophisticated SQL models to process both batch and near real-time data streams.
  • Utilize dbt to implement reliable, version-controlled transformation logic.
  • Ensure high performance and cost-efficiency within the Snowflake environment.
  • Build and maintain scalable ELT/ETL processes to support the organization's evolving data needs.



Skills & Experience:

  • Proven experience working with Snowflake architecture (Virtual Warehouses, Snowpipe, etc.).
  • Strong proficiency in using dbt for modular data modeling and testing.
  • Expert-level ability to write complex, performant, and clean SQL code.
  • Solid understanding of data warehousing concepts, schema design (Star, Snowflake, Data Vault), and data lifecycle management.
  • A proactive approach to problem-solving and a passion for deep-diving into technical challenges.

 

Nice to Have:

  • Real-time Processing: Previous experience building SQL models specifically for real-time data pipelines.
  • Experience with orchestration tools (e.g., Airflow, Dagster) or cloud platforms (AWS/Azure/GCP).

Required languages

English B2 - Upper Intermediate
SQL, Snowflake, dbt
Published 19 March
44 views
ยท
9 applications
23% read
To apply for this and other jobs on Djinni login or signup.
Loading...